HD install loading wrong network module

Post Reply
Message
Author
NoWayBill
Posts: 1
Joined: Sat 19 Apr 2008, 00:17

HD install loading wrong network module

#1 Post by NoWayBill »

I installed, HDD, Puppy on a Compaq Armada 7800 (266mhz, 64m RAM).
It networks with a 3Com 3c562d PCMCIA, however, Puppy is loading module 3c589_cs.
It claims to be able to "see" the network, but my router is not seeing it.

I tried loading the correct driver using ndiswrapper, this file works in DSL & TinyFlux.
But Puppy barks out an "invalid driver" message.
I believe the system is trying to configure another NIC (eth1), thinking that eth0 is correctly configured.

How do I kill the kmod 3c589_cs so that I can load 3comnet1.inf into ndiswrapper?

EDIT:
OK got the kmod removed, however still getting "invalid driver" message.
The help file says there should be a *.cat file with the *.inf, DSL and TinyFlux required a *.sys file.

User avatar
Aitch
Posts: 6518
Joined: Wed 04 Apr 2007, 15:57
Location: Chatham, Kent, UK

#2 Post by Aitch »

Hi

I believe you need to add rmmod 3c589_cs to your rc.local file and reboot
Then load ndiswrapper or load it in the rc.local file, using the network wizard

There's probably a CLI way but I'm not that well versed

Try it - what's the worst that can happen

Here's a howto for a different wifi to show the steps

http://www.murga-linux.com/puppy/viewto ... bd977804df

In the event something goes wrong, you will have to reboot with pfix=ram or pfix=purge at bootup, that's all

Aitch :)

Post Reply